Galatolo, Stefano Orbit complexity by computable structures. (English) Zbl 0996.37012 Nonlinearity 13, No. 5, 1531-1546 (2000). Summary: We give a definition of orbit complexity for points in topological systems over separable metric spaces. Our definition extends Brudno’s definition meaningfully to the non-compact case. Interacting with constructive mathematics we investigate questions about orbit complexity from a new point of view. In particular, we show a relation between constructivity, entropy and orbit complexity.
